In Bountiful, Utah, data recovery became essential when a Western Digital WD5000AAJB 500 GB hard drive stopped spinning. The customer recalled that the device might have been dropped years ago, likely causing hidden damage. Later, an attempt was made to fix the issue by swapping the logic board, but the drive still remained unresponsive. Inside were valuable documents, spreadsheets, scanned files, videos, and pictures — files too important to lose.
That’s when they contacted WeRecoverData, the leading data recovery company.
Upon inspection, the experts at WeRecoverData confirmed that the non-spinning drive showed signs of serious internal failure, possibly affecting the motor or read/write heads. Because a board swap had already been attempted, the engineers carefully reviewed the compatibility of the replacement before proceeding.
In a certified cleanroom environment, the team performed a precise head stack replacement using donor parts from a matching drive. Once the drive was stabilized, they applied advanced data recovery techniques to safely extract the lost files.
The result was a complete success. Despite the physical damage and earlier repair attempts, all of the customer’s important files were recovered. When the data was returned, the customer was relieved and thankful to have their memories and documents restored.
